What MFA Actually Is

Multi-factor authentication, or MFA, is a second lock on your accounts. You might also see it called two-factor authentication, or 2FA. Same idea, different name.

Here's the concept: instead of just asking for your password, a website or app asks for something else too. Usually a short code that gets sent to your phone, or generated by an app.

The logic is straightforward. Even if someone has your password, they probably don't also have your phone. So they can't get in.

One lock. Two keys. Much harder to copy both.

Why Your Password Alone Isn't Enough

Passwords get stolen in ways that have nothing to do with you being careless.

A company you have an account with gets hacked. Your email and password end up in a list that gets sold on the internet. Someone tries that combination on your bank, your email, your Amazon account. If you use the same password in multiple places, they're in.

This happens constantly. Billions of stolen credentials are floating around online right now. Security researchers track these lists. The numbers aren't small.

The uncomfortable truth is that a strong password helps, but it's not a complete defense on its own. MFA is what closes the gap.

The Three Types You'll Actually Encounter

Text message codes. You log in, and a six-digit code gets sent to your phone. You type it in. Done. This is the most common version and the easiest to set up. It's not perfect, but it's dramatically better than nothing.

Authenticator apps. An app on your phone generates a fresh six-digit code every 30 seconds. Google Authenticator and Microsoft Authenticator are the two most common. You open the app, type the current code, and you're in. Slightly more setup, meaningfully more secure than text messages.

Passkeys and hardware keys. These are newer and less common for everyday use. A passkey ties your login to your specific device using biometrics, like your fingerprint or face. A hardware key is a small physical device you plug in. Both are excellent. You'll encounter them more as time goes on.

For most people, text message codes or an authenticator app is the right starting point.

"But It's So Annoying"

Fair. It does add a step.

Here's the thing though: most apps and websites only ask for the second factor when you're logging in from a new device or location. Once your laptop or phone is recognized, you often won't see it again for weeks.

The inconvenience is real but small. The protection is real and significant.

Think about it this way. A deadbolt takes two extra seconds to lock. Nobody skips it because it's inconvenient. MFA is the deadbolt for your accounts.

Where to Turn It On First

Not everything needs MFA immediately, but these do:

Email. Your email is the master key to everything else. If someone gets into your email, they can reset the password on every other account you have. This one is non-negotiable.

Banking and financial accounts. Most banks already require it. If yours doesn't offer it, that's worth noting.

Apple ID or Google account. These accounts are tied to your phone, your photos, your contacts, and often your payment information. Protect them.

Social media. Less critical than the above, but account takeovers on Facebook and Instagram are extremely common and often used to scam your contacts.

How to Turn It On

Every service is slightly different, but the path is almost always the same:

Go to your account settings. Look for "Security" or "Privacy." Find something labeled "Two-factor authentication," "Two-step verification," or "Multi-factor authentication." Follow the prompts.

The Bottom Line

MFA won't make you unhackable. Nothing will. But it stops the most common type of account takeover cold, the kind where someone has your password and tries to use it.

It's a second lock. It takes a few minutes to set up. And once it's on, you mostly forget it's there.
